published by dereine on 25. September 2009 - 10:18
Oft möchte man ein Formularelement schreiben, welches als Auswahlmöglichkeit alle Inhaltstypen bieten sollen.
Das kann man einfach mit
<?php
$options = node_get_types('names');
?>
published by dereine on 20. August 2009 - 19:30
Ein Einsatz von Panels ist oft, für einen bestimmten Content-Typ einen Tab zu platzieren.
Natürlich kann man dafür Panels verwenden, aber das Modul ansich ist natürlich schon recht groß.
Alternativ kann man sich auch sein kleines Mini-Modul schreiben:
<?php
// $Id$
/**
* Implementation of hook_menu().
*/
function example_menu_menu() {
$items['node/%node/tab1'] = array(
'title' => 'tab1',
// die wichtige Funktion:
// Sie wird bei jedem Aufruf von node/$nid aufgerufen
'access callback' => 'example_per_nodetype',
published by dereine on 17. May 2009 - 21:49
published by holzi on 11. March 2009 - 7:58
Die Cebit ist vorbei und ich (Holzi) war einer der jenigen die auf dem Drupal-Stand den Besucher erklärt haben was man mit Drupal so alles machen kann. Das hat mir als Webseiten-Besitzer sehr viel Spass gemacht, aber da viele Fragen offengebliben sind und es doch sehr viel Anregungen gab. Habe ich dereine gefragt ob ich bei Ihm mitblogen kann, damit ich ein wenig über Drupal schreiben kann, als Webmaster und nicht als Entwickler. Also werde ich soweit es die Zeit zu lässt, ab und zu hier blogen über Drupal und was man so für Fragen, Problem oder gar Lösungen braucht als Webmaster.
published by dereine on 27. July 2008 - 20:29
Gestern Abend kam die Frage ob man die Kommentare auch an anderer Stelle als unter dem Node anzeigen könnte. Nach dem Nachlesen im Quellcode war sofort klar, dass es dafür bisher keine Themefunktion gibt. Eine anderer Lösung als Themefunktionen sind in dr6 der Hook hook_menu_alter($callbacks), welcher die Menu Struktur verändern lässt und man so wirklich alles verändern kann
<?php
/**
* Implementation of hook_menu_alter()
*/
function custom_comment_menu_alter(&$callbacks) {
dsm("hier");